Output 81912a1e5684bae86ed6236affcec121c180ce0ab9951018b30cf23c88620052:5

value
599900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ccd568d8014ed4a5f656a12c2ddf8cd1404f601 OP_EQUALVERIFY OP_CHECKSIG
address
1AvHxros6DbQEH5284HxyMZp6pDNvVzFFA
transaction
81912a1e5684bae86ed6236affcec121c180ce0ab9951018b30cf23c88620052
spent
true